Maintenance Planning for Continuous Operation

Replacing the DS3800NERA1P1D in a Mark V Speedtronic panel is rarely an isolated task. Maintenance engineers performing a board-level replacement should treat this as an opportunity for a comprehensive control cabinet inspection. The analog microprocessor board interfaces directly with the system’s I/O infrastructure, power distribution, and communication backbone — any degraded component in these adjacent circuits can cause the replacement board to underperform or fail prematurely.

Begin by inspecting the DS3800NPPC power supply board, which provides regulated DC power to the analog processing section. A marginal power supply is a leading cause of analog board failures and must be verified before commissioning the replacement DS3800NERA1P1D. Similarly, the DS3800NDAC digital-to-analog converter board should be checked for output drift, as it works in tandem with the analog microprocessor to generate control signals for actuators and valves.

Inspect all DS3800 series terminal boards for corrosion, loose wiring, and damaged screw terminals. These boards carry the field wiring for thermocouples, RTDs, 4–20 mA transmitters, and discrete I/O — any poor connection here will introduce noise or signal errors that can be misdiagnosed as a board fault. The DS3800HMPG Mark V processor board should also be evaluated during the same maintenance window, as it coordinates with the analog board for overall turbine sequencing logic.

For communication integrity, verify the DS3800NCSA communication board and associated serial or Ethernet interface modules. Mark V systems in networked environments rely on these modules for SCADA integration and remote monitoring; a degraded communication board can mask analog faults or delay alarm response. If the panel includes a DS3800NPSB power supply board as a redundant supply, test its switchover function under load.

Signal isolation is critical in turbine control environments. Check any installed signal isolators or signal conditioners on the analog input channels — particularly on thermocouple and RTD inputs where ground loops are common. Fuse holders and DIN-rail mounted fuse blocks protecting the 24 VDC and 120 VAC circuits should be inspected and fuses replaced as part of the planned maintenance cycle. Finally, review the HMI workstation connected to the Mark V panel: outdated HMI software or a failing HMI communication card can prevent operators from confirming that the replacement board has been accepted by the control system.

Site Replacement Workflow

The DS3800NERA1P1D is a direct replacement for earlier analog microprocessor board revisions used in GE Mark V Speedtronic panels. Before beginning the replacement, document the existing board’s slot position, jumper settings, and any site-specific configuration labels. Power down the affected section of the control panel following your site’s lockout/tagout procedure, and discharge any residual capacitance on the backplane before removing the board.

Insert the replacement DS3800NERA1P1D into the correct slot, ensuring the edge connector is fully seated and the board retention latch is engaged. Restore power and observe the system’s self-test sequence on the Mark V operator interface. Confirm that all analog input channels are reading within expected ranges and that no fault codes are active before returning the turbine to service. This structured approach minimizes downtime, eliminates guesswork, and ensures that the replacement board is fully integrated into the control system before the unit is restarted.
